How troponin i high sensitivity Actually Works

So, what exactly is troponin i high sensitivity, and how does it work? troponin i is a protein found in heart muscle cells that's released into the bloodstream when damage occurs. Traditional troponin tests can detect elevated levels of troponin i, but they often struggle to differentiate between heart damage and other causes of troponin elevation. High-sensitivity troponin tests, on the other hand, can detect even tiny amounts of troponin i, making it possible to diagnose heart damage earlier and more accurately.

Common Questions People Have About troponin i high sensitivity

Key Insights

  • Is troponin i high sensitivity a replacement for traditional troponin tests? Not quite. While troponin i high sensitivity is a more accurate and sensitive test, it's often used in conjunction with traditional troponin tests to provide a more complete picture of a patient's heart health.* Can troponin i high sensitivity detect all types of heart damage? No, troponin i high sensitivity is primarily used to detect myocardial infarction (heart attack) and other types of heart damage that involve the release of troponin i into the bloodstream.* Is troponin i high sensitivity available in all medical settings? While troponin i high sensitivity is becoming increasingly available, it may not be widely available in all medical settings. Patients should check with their healthcare provider to see if this test is available at their local hospital or medical facility.
